The Nonprofit Ecosystem in Lakeland

Lakeland is home to 1k nonprofit organizations. In aggregate, these organizations account for $2b in revenue and employ 19k individuals.

Police Athletic League Of Lakeland Inc

Lakeland, FL

Assets: $170k

Revenue: $150k

MISSION:

OUR MISSION TO PROMOTE POSITIVE INTERACTION BETWEEN THE YOUTH IN THE COMMUNITY AND THE LAKELAND POLICE DEPARTMENT USING EDUCATIONAL AND RECREATIONAL ACTIVITIES DIRECTED THROUGH A VARIETY OF YOUTH PROGRAMMING. GOALS & PHILOSOPHY THE GOAL OF THE LAKELAND POLICE ATHLETIC LEAGUE (PAL) IS TO PROVIDE ENRICHING PROGRAMS FOR THE YOUTH OF THE COMMUNITY THAT ARE FUN AND WILL INSPIRE THEM TO LEARN AND PRACTICE THE VALUES OF SPORTSMANSHIP, SCHOLARSHIP, AND PHYSICAL FITNESS.
